摘要:
提出了一种采用运动学中空间位移的方法,基于可变形NURBS(D-NURBS)自由曲线构造数控加工中刀具扫描体曲面的CAD模型,使原来的几何曲线曲面具有物理曲面的特性,这样就允许设计人员以自然的、可预测的方法运用许多基于力的工具进行交互式造型,直接设计型面.所得曲面易满足所使用的特殊的数控加工机床的运动和动力学限制,同时得到了自由曲面数控加工的刀具路径设计的新方法,该方法将运动学、计算机辅助几何设计与CAD/CAM技术结合起来,为并行几何形状设计和制造提供了基础.
Abstract:
A method of spatial displacement in kinematics is proposed to construct a CAD model of the scanned surface of the tool in CNC machining based on the deformable NURBS (D-NURBS) free curve, so that the original geometric curve surface has the characteristics of a physical surface, which allows designers to use many force-based tools to interactively shape and directly design the profile in a natural and predictable way. The resulting surface is easy to meet the motion and dynamics limitations of the special CNC machining machine used, and at the same time obtains a new method of toolpath design for freeform CNC machining, which combines kinematics, computer-aided geometric design and CAD/CAM technology to provide a basis for parallel geometry design and manufacturing.
